About Expunged Chronicle of Miroku (1989) — A Ninja's War Beneath the Stars

In *Expunged Chronicle of Miroku (1989)*, visionary anime director Yoshio Takeuchi crafts a haunting fusion of ninja lore and cosmic horror. The story follows a lone psychic assassin in a hidden war beneath Japan's surface, where remnants of an ancient Sengoku-era clan battle extraterrestrial occupiers from a colossal crashed spaceship. With its eerie blend of samurai action and sci-fi dread, the film immerses viewers in a shadowy underworld of espionage, supernatural powers, and forgotten history.

Led by Hideyuki Hori and Koji Totani, the stellar voice cast elevates this surreal narrative, while Takeuchi's direction weaves together elements of fantasy and horror into a uniquely Japanese tapestry.
